A Pharmacist plays a critical role in the pharmacy industry, ensuring patients receive the correct medications and understand how to use them safely and effectively. They review and interpret physician orders, detect potential medication interactions, dispense prescribed medications, and counsel patients on their proper usage and potential side effects. Additionally, they provide advice on healthy lifestyles, conduct health screenings, manage immunization programs, and oversee the work of pharmacy technicians and interns. Pharmacists often work in community pharmacies, hospitals, clinics, or they may work in research or the pharmaceutical industry.
Pharmacists are required to have a Doctor of Pharmacy (Pharm.D.) degree from an accredited college or university. They must also pass two exams to become licensed: the North American Pharmacist Licensure Exam (NAPLEX) and, in most states, the Multistate Pharmacy Jurisprudence Exam (MPJE). Important skills for a Pharmacist include strong communication and organizational skills, attention to detail, the ability to work with a diverse population, and the capacity to handle stressful situations. Prior to becoming a Pharmacist, individuals often work as Pharmacy Technicians, Pharmacy Interns, or in related health care roles to gain practical experience in the field.
